Kutuzovskaya (Russian: Кутузовская) is a station on the Moscow Central Circle of the Moscow Metro that opened in September 2016.

Name

Originally planned to be named Kutuzovo, the city altered the name slightly to Kutuzovskaya in concert with the connecting station Kutuzovskaya on Filyovskaya Line.[1]

Transfer

Passengers may make free out-of-station transfers to Kutuzovskaya station on the Filyovskaya Line. It is also possible to make a free transfer to the Arbatsko-Pokrovskaya Line and Kalininsko-Solntsevskaya Line at Park Pobedy; however the distance of more than one kilometer makes this impractical.
